> To OASIS Members:
> 
> This is a Call For Vote to approve the following Committee Specification set as
> an OASIS Standard: 
> 
> Metadata Profile for the OASIS Security Assertion Markup Language (SAML) V1.x
> 
> Documents:
> http://docs.oasis-open.org/security/saml/Post2.0/sstc-saml1x-metadata-cs-01.html
> 
> http://docs.oasis-open.org/security/saml/Post2.0/sstc-saml1x-metadata-cs-01.pdf
> 
> http://docs.oasis-open.org/security/saml/Post2.0/sstc-saml1x-metadata-cs-01.odt
> 
> Schema:
> http://docs.oasis-open.org/security/saml/Post2.0/sstc-saml1x-metadata.xsd
> 
> Ballot:
> http://www.oasis-open.org/apps/org/workgroup/voting/ballot.php?id=1375
> 
> The Committee Specification has had its required 60 day public review, and the
> review materials were sent out to the membership of OASIS for the required
> 15-day familiarization period. (Those materials can be found at:
> http://lists.oasis-open.org/archives/tc-announce/200710/msg00001.html.) As the
> required review and familiarization periods have now been completed it is time
> to vote. The applicable section of the OASIS TC Process is at:
> http://www.oasis-open.org/committees/process.php#3.4.
> 
> Voting to approve the work product of our Technical Committees is a key step in
> the OASIS process, to better assure our broader user community of the quality
> and applicability of the methods or TCs create.  I strongly encourage each
> member organization to consider the works submitted for approval and participate
> by casting a ballot.
> 
> As each OASIS member organization has only one vote, participating employees of
> your organization should provide their input to you, their voting
> representative, so that you can decide how to vote on behalf of your
> organization.  We point that out to them, on our general [members] list,
> concurrently with this message.
> 
> The voting representative from each OASIS member organization should submit the
> organization's vote by 11:45 p.m. Eastern Standard Time (US) 31 Oct 2007. Voting
> will be conducted using the OASIS member database tools. To cast your ballots,
> go to the Voting group ballot page at: 
> http://www.oasis-open.org/apps/org/workgroup/voting/ballots.php. You will need
> to log-in to the database tools in order to cast your ballots; if you have not
> yet obtained your username and password please contact Scott McGrath
> (scott.mcgrath@oasis-open.org) for help.
> 
> You may change your ballot until the time that balloting closes. Ballots will be
> publicly archived. Comments may be made but are not solicited as the
> specifications already have been subject to public review.
